import config from '@automattic/calypso-config';
import { localizeUrl } from '@automattic/i18n-utils';
import { useEffect, useRef } from 'react';
import { useDispatch } from 'react-redux';
import { updateNonce } from 'calypso/state/login/actions';
import { remoteLoginUser } from 'calypso/state/login/actions/remote-login-user';
import {
getTwoFactorAuthNonce,
getTwoFactorPushToken,
getTwoFactorUserId,
} from 'calypso/state/login/selectors';
const POLL_APP_PUSH_INTERVAL = 5 * 1000;
async function request( state ) {
const url = localizeUrl(
'https://wordpress.com/wp-login.php?action=two-step-authentication-endpoint'
);
const body = new URLSearchParams( {
user_id: getTwoFactorUserId( state ),
auth_type: 'push',
remember_me: true,
two_step_nonce: getTwoFactorAuthNonce( state, 'push' ),
two_step_push_token: getTwoFactorPushToken( state ),
client_id: config( 'wpcom_signup_id' ),
client_secret: config( 'wpcom_signup_key' ),
} );
const response = await fetch( url, {
method: 'POST',
credentials: 'include',
body,
} );
return await response.json();
}
const poll = ( signal ) => async ( dispatch, getState ) => {
let aborted = false;
signal.addEventListener( 'abort', () => {
aborted = true;
} );
// POST to `/wp-login.php` every 5 seconds until the push notification is approved and
// the endpoint reports success.
while ( true ) {
try {
const response = await request( getState() );
// in case of success, do remote login (optionally) and break out of the loop
if ( response.success ) {
const tokenLinks = response.data.token_links;
if ( Array.isArray( tokenLinks ) ) {
await remoteLoginUser( tokenLinks );
}
return true;
}
// in case of failure (HTTP 403 response with `{ success: false }` in the JSON body),
// read and store the new nonce and continue to poll.
const twoStepNonce = response.data.two_step_nonce;
// if there is a `success: false` response without a nonce, that means
// we can't do the next iteration of the loop and we need to abort.
if ( ! twoStepNonce ) {
return false;
}
dispatch( updateNonce( 'push', twoStepNonce ) );
} catch {
// continue polling if the request fails with a network-ish failure, i.e., when `fetch` throws
// an error instead of returning a `Response` or when the `response.json()` can't be read.
}
// the poller component that starts the polling loop will abort it on unmount
if ( aborted ) {
return false;
}
await new Promise( ( r ) => setTimeout( r, POLL_APP_PUSH_INTERVAL ) );
}
};
export default function PushNotificationApprovalPoller( { onSuccess } ) {
const dispatch = useDispatch();
const savedOnSuccess = useRef();
useEffect( () => {
savedOnSuccess.current = onSuccess;
}, [ onSuccess ] );
useEffect( () => {
const abortController = new AbortController();
dispatch( poll( abortController.signal ) )
.then( ( success ) => {
if ( success ) {
savedOnSuccess.current();
}
} )
.catch( () => {} );
return () => abortController.abort();
}, [ dispatch ] );
return null;
}
